I've had a few Aquaclears to not start after an outage but no harm came to
the impeller well, the motor or the impeller itself. After cleaning the
slime off the impeller magnet, and the well itself - they'd start right up
again. My Fluval always started after a power outage.

This has been my experience as well (no damage), but I guess 30 hours
with extra heat from the magnetic field, and no cooling water to flow
past caused the hot spot to warp the plastic, further seizing the
impeller.
This is worrisome for office tanks which are left alone for the weekend,
and I don't see many practical preventatives (monitor electrical current
to interrupt power, monitor water flow to interrupt power or clean
impeller well religiously). I suspect different filters will have
different susceptibilities to this failure mode.

The situation of not starting after a power interruption is not unique to
Hagen. It's more of a characteristic of magnetic impellers. The force
required to spin them is much smaller than the force required to start
them, so a bit of resistance from debris can cause them to not start.
Ironically, I think this is partly by design as they made the motors
smaller (cheaper, less heat generated, less electricity consumed). When
magnetic impellers were invented (I was in the hobby then, as many others
here) they were more powerful, so they rarely didn't restart from debris,
but they often didn't restart because of alignment. Instead of a well,
they used a platter, and the slightest misalignment would magnify itself
and wear the blades down from rubbing. When they lost power, they would
throw themselves over to a side so far as to not restart again. I
probably still have a box of impeller blades which have all been slightly
modified for balance. We are relatively spoiled today ;~).
